Asbestos Trusts

Asbestos victims family members, as well as the companies that exploited asbestos should be compensated for the past and future medical costs, lost wages, and suffering and pain. The asbestos companies should be held accountable for their lapses in concealing the dangers of asbestos and making money from asbestos. An attorney for mesothelioma will know how to collect the evidence required and file your claim on behalf.

Trust funds for asbestos are the financial options available to asbestos-related victims. Asbestos manufacturers set trusts to protect asbestos victims as part of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ection, which shields them from lawsuits, but requires them to pay into the trust. The trustee supervises the trust and determines how much money is paid to victims. Individuals may have the option to claim compensation from more than one asbestos trust funds.

The time frame for the payout of trust funds varies depending on the case. A mesothelioma lawyer with experience can assist you in filing for an expedited review to ensure your claim is processed quicker. An expedited review usually offers a fixed payout amount based on the kind of asbestos-related disease being diagnosed. Your attorney may request an individual review, which takes a more detailed look at the evidence in your case and assigns a specific value to your diagnosis.

Individual reviews typically take longer than expedited reviews, however they are able to take into account more of the specific circumstances that surround your case. This includes your work history and the type of asbestos that you were exposed to, which could result in a higher payout than the amounts provided by the expedited review process.
